Message type: E = Error
Message class: PHIN - Phase In: Messages
Message number: 479
Message text: Specify only one installation location; equipment or functional location

- Specify only one installation location; equipment or functional location ?The SAP error message PHIN479 indicates that there is an issue with the assignment of installation locations in the system. Specifically, it means that the system expects either an equipment or a functional location to be specified, but both have been provided, or neither has been specified. This can occur in various contexts, such as when creating or modifying maintenance plans, work orders, or other related objects in SAP PM (Plant Maintenance).
Cause:
- Multiple Entries: The user may have inadvertently entered both an equipment number and a functional location in a field that only allows one of them.
- Missing Data: The system may not have received the necessary data to determine which installation location to use.
- Configuration Issues: There may be configuration settings in the SAP system that are not aligned with the expected input for the transaction being performed.
Solution:
Check Input Fields: Review the input fields in the transaction where the error occurred. Ensure that only one of the following is specified:
- Equipment Number
- Functional Location If both are filled, remove one of them based on your requirements.
Review Transaction Context: Understand the context of the transaction. For example, if you are creating a maintenance order, ensure that you are only linking it to either a piece of equipment or a functional location, not both.
Consult Documentation: Refer to SAP documentation or help files related to the specific transaction to understand the expected input and any constraints.
Check Configuration: If the issue persists, consult with your SAP administrator or a functional consultant to review the configuration settings related to the PM module. There may be settings that need adjustment to align with your business processes.
Testing: After making the necessary adjustments, test the transaction again to ensure that the error is resolved.
